Paper Title: SMART ACCIDENT RESCUE SYSTEM
Authors Name: PERAM VENKATA CHAITANYA REDDY , SAJIDHA THABASSUM , KURUBA ABHISHEK , LALRAMKINLOVA , MANI N R

Abstract: As we witness in our day-to-day life, there are many accidents caused in the road transport. Every day hundreds to thousands of people die due to accidents or are also affected minor or in a severe level due to accidents. It is very important to develop and research some technologies which will avoid accidents, and enable the owner to track the vehicles when there is a large transportation systems. This system will help such transporters as well as ambulances and other vehicle transportation in reducing the risk of accidents. This system is able to differentiate between normal and abnormal movement of vehicles which will therefore notify the owner and will also help in reducing accident causing situations. The rash driving of the driver is detected and the owner is informed about the rash driving along with the location of the driver. This is the important feature of our proposed project. The project also helps in detecting alcohol content in the vehicle. If present, the immediate notification will be sent to the user or the owner and the location will be shared through SMS.
Keywords: ESP32 Wi-Fi Module, MQ3 Alcohol Sensor, GPS, GSM, IR Sensor, Ultrasonic Sensor, Accident Rescue, Tracking.
